C 实现整型数值的拆分
&这里多提几句,开始本来想实现一下float的拆分发现并没有什么必要,由于浮点数在计算机存储方式的原因,会造成浮点数精度的丢失。其实真正的浮点数有效位数只有6位。
怎么说呢自己可以去试一下 float f=3.1415963 float f2=f-(int)f 自己去试一下结果就知道了。
赞 (0)
&这里多提几句,开始本来想实现一下float的拆分发现并没有什么必要,由于浮点数在计算机存储方式的原因,会造成浮点数精度的丢失。其实真正的浮点数有效位数只有6位。
怎么说呢自己可以去试一下 float f=3.1415963 float f2=f-(int)f 自己去试一下结果就知道了。